Matching Your Refrigerator’s Water Inlet
A common pitfall when purchasing a refrigerator water line is incorrect fitting size. Most refrigerators and water sources utilize 1/4 compression fittings. However, some may have a 3/8 outlet at the angle stop.
Kits like the Refrigerator Ice Maker Water Line Kit – 10′ Braided Stainless explicitly mention 3/8 OD compression inlets, ensuring compatibility. Always double-check the connection size on both your refrigerator’s water inlet valve and your home’s existing water shut-off valve to avoid the need for adapters or a return trip to the store.

Connector types and compatibility
Ensure the water supply line features 1/4 OD (Outer Diameter) compression fittings, the standard for most refrigerator water connections. Both ends should have this size to connect securely to your home’s water shut-off valve and the refrigerator’s inlet valve. Verify that the threads are standard NPT (National Pipe Thread), which are tapered and self-sealing when tightened correctly.
A good connector will have a nut and ferrule that create a robust, leakproof seal. Always choose lines with identical, standard 1/4 OD compression fittings on both ends for guaranteed compatibility and a watertight, worry-free installation.

Frequently Asked Questions
What Is The Best Type Of Material For A Fridge Water Supply Line?
Braided stainless steel is generally considered the best material for a fridge water supply line due to its exceptional durability and resistance to kinking and bursting. This robust construction ensures a long-lasting and reliable connection for your refrigerator’s water dispenser and ice maker.
How Long Should A Water Supply Line For A Refrigerator Be?
The ideal length for a refrigerator water supply line depends on your specific setup, typically ranging from 5 to 10 feet. Always measure the distance from your water source to the fridge, adding a few extra feet for slack to prevent strain and facilitate installation.
Are Plastic Or Braided Stainless Steel Water Lines Better For Refrigerators?
Braided stainless steel lines are superior to plastic for refrigerators because they offer significantly greater strength, flexibility, and resistance to damage. This prevents premature wear, leaks, and potential water damage, ensuring a more secure and dependable water connection.
What Are Common Connection Sizes For Refrigerator Water Lines?
The most common connection size for refrigerator water lines is 1/4 inch OD (Outer Diameter) compression fitting. This standard size ensures compatibility with most refrigerators and water source valves, making installation straightforward without specialized tools.
How Do I Ensure My Fridge Water Supply Line Won’T Leak?
To prevent leaks, ensure the connectors on your fridge water supply line are the correct size and type for both your refrigerator and water source. Tighten fittings securely but avoid over-tightening, which can damage threads. Using Teflon tape on threaded connections can also enhance the seal.
